American Honors operates in the higher education sector with a focus on making high-quality education more affordable for today’s college-bound students. The organization draws on a wide spectrum of experience, spanning community colleges, public and private universities, and professionals with credentials from PhDs to associate degrees, as well as ties to entrepreneurial startups and Fortune 500 companies. This diverse perspective informs an approach to higher education that seeks to deliver greater value amid rising tuition costs and a challenging work environment. The overarching aim is to enable students to reach their full potential.

The company is based in Washington, DC. A development noted in its history is a 2015 partnership with Hale Education Group to increase American university applications from the GCC by 50%.
